The following items are my advice for your application.
(1) Firmware for AP
don't forget load xxx_ap.bin file when loading a WIFI driver to your system.
(2) hostapd executive file
After compiling android source code, you should find hostapd file at path "system/bin", the file will be used to start AP service( see init.freescale.rc)
(3) About hostapd.conf
When you select WIFI access point in android WIFI setting, hostapd.conf file will be automatically created at path "data/misc/wifi/" by upper wifi application.
(4) Starting hostapd service
Android BSP for SabreSDP board supports WIFI ap, you can find corresponding commands in init.freescale.rc file.
(5) About wpa_supplicant.conf
You can search much valuable experience from internet, the following is an example.
